Giorgio Armani: Buongiorno, New York

By Alessandra Ilari MILAN ? Welcome to Giorgio a-go-go.

With an energy level that would exhaust even the fittest, the designer landed in New York Sunday for a 48-hour whirlwind visit that included checking in on the progress of his new flagship, attending the Metropolitan Museum’s Costume Institute gala, making a personal appearance at Saks Fifth Avenue, being honored with the first Couture Council Award for Global Fashion Leadership and participating in a question-and-answer session with students at the Fashion Institute of Technology.

“It will be like being in apnea with a program that changes every five minutes,” joked Armani during an interview in his Via Borgonuovo offices here before the trip.

Immediately after landing in Manhattan from Antigua, Armani stopped to check the progress of the flagship he’s building on Fifth Avenue slated to open early next year. Seeing the gutted interior of the 47,000-square-foot unit for the first time, he said, “I was curious to see this store. New York needs glamour. It needs size. This store is an act of faith toward the Americans and Fifth Avenue shoppers because I still very much believe in this market in which I invested a lot,” said Armani.

His next appointment of the day was a walk-through of the “Superheroes” exhibition, accompanied by Vogue editor in chief Anna Wintour ? with whom the designer had a much-talked-about dustup in Milan in February ? and Harold Koda and Andrew Bolton of the Costume Institute.

Armani has contributed three looks to the exhibition ? a specially made sculptured dress with exaggerated slopey shoulders that he described as a latter-day Barbarella, but was quick to point out doesn’t pertain to his taste; a Giorgio Armani dress with a spiderweb-looking overlay from the spring 1990 collection, and an Emporio men’s wear outfit from fall 2007.

At tonight’s Met gala, Armani will be honorary chair, with co-chairs Wintour, George Clooney and Julia Roberts. The two actors plus Sarah Larson, Tom Cruise, Katie Holmes, David and Victoria Beckham and Camilla Belle all will don Armani. In fact, Roberts was spotted having a fitting for her dress on Friday.
